java判斷回文數(shù)示例分享
更新時間:2014年03月26日 09:29:49 投稿:zxhpj
這篇文章主要介紹了java判斷回文數(shù)示例,需要的朋友可以參考下
判斷一個數(shù)是不是回文數(shù)示例,回文數(shù)就是原數(shù)與其倒置后的數(shù)相等,如:123321,到之后仍為123321,即為回文數(shù)
題目:一個5位數(shù),判斷它是不是回文數(shù)。即12321是回文數(shù),個位與萬位相同,十位與千位相同。
/**
* 判斷一個數(shù)是不是回文數(shù),回文數(shù)就是原數(shù)與其倒置后的數(shù)相等
* 如:123321,到之后仍為123321,即為回文數(shù)
* @author lvpeiqiang
*/
public class HuiWenShu
{
public boolean isHuiWenShu(int num)
{
int s = 0;
int bNum = num;
int mod;
//以下為把數(shù)值倒置的方法
while(bNum != 0)
{
mod = bNum%10; //123%10 = 3
s = s*10 + mod; //s = 0*10+3
bNum = bNum/10; //bNum = 123/10=12(int自動轉(zhuǎn)換)
}
boolean b = (s == num);
return b;
}
public static void main(String[] args)
{
HuiWenShu p = new HuiWenShu();
boolean b = p.isHuiWenShu(123321);
System.out.println(b);
}
}
您可能感興趣的文章:
- Java判斷字符串回文的代碼實例
- java 實現(xiàn)判斷回文數(shù)字的實例代碼
- Java版本的回文字算法(java版本)
- Java實現(xiàn)查找當前字符串最大回文串代碼分享
- java計算任意位水仙花數(shù)示例(回文數(shù))
- Java實現(xiàn)帶頭結(jié)點的單鏈表
- java實現(xiàn)單鏈表增刪改查的實例代碼詳解
- Java數(shù)據(jù)結(jié)構(gòu)之簡單鏈表的定義與實現(xiàn)方法示例
- Java實現(xiàn)單鏈表翻轉(zhuǎn)實例代碼
- java 實現(xiàn)單鏈表逆轉(zhuǎn)詳解及實例代碼
- Java實現(xiàn)單鏈表的各種操作
- 用JAVA實現(xiàn)單鏈表,檢測字符串是否是回文串
相關文章
Java中Cookie和Session詳解及區(qū)別總結(jié)
這篇文章主要介紹了Java中Cookie和Session詳解,文章圍繞主題展開詳細的內(nèi)容介紹,具有一定的參考價值,感興趣的小伙伴可以參考一下2022-06-06
java基于mongodb實現(xiàn)分布式鎖的示例代碼
本文主要介紹了java基于mongodb實現(xiàn)分布式鎖,文中通過示例代碼介紹的非常詳細,具有一定的參考價值,感興趣的小伙伴們可以參考一下2021-08-08

